Burcon Reports Fiscal 2015 Third Quarter Results


VANCOUVER, British Columbia, Feb. 16, 2015 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Burcon NutraScience Corporation (TSX:BU) (Nasdaq:BUR), a leader in functional, renewable plant proteins, reported results for the fiscal third quarter ended December 31, 2014.

Fiscal 2015 Third Quarter Operational Highlights

  • Advanced discussions with a select group of multi-national food ingredient providers about a royalty or a joint operations agreement for Peazazz®.
  • Burcon's Winnipeg Technical Centre continued Peazazz® applications work and sample production in response to requests from and in support of the analytical work being conducted by potential commercialization partners.
  • Burcon's exclusive manufacturing and marketing partner for CLARISOY™ soy protein, Archer Daniels Midland Company (ADM), facilitated CLARISOY™ development activities in the global food and beverage market while operating the world's first CLARISOY™ semi-works plant to produce samples of the CLARISOY™ soy protein line for market development purposes.
  • ADM completed its acquisition of WILD Flavors GmbH and formed a new business unit, WILD Flavors and Specialty Ingredients, which includes the WILD business as well as ADM's specialty proteins product line among others.
  • Burcon filed two new patent applications and received a U.S. patent grant and a U.S. patent allowance. Including another U.S. patent grant subsequent to the quarter-end, the Company's patent portfolio comprises 182 issued patents in various countries, including 57 in the U.S., as well as more than 390 active patent applications, including 65 additional U.S. patent applications.
  • Subsequent to the quarter-end, Burcon completed a private placement with a respected group of U.S.-based investors for U.S.$1.65 million.

Fiscal Third Quarter Financial Results (Dollars in Canadian)

Revenues totaled $31,000 in the third quarter, as compared to $24,000 in the prior quarter and the same quarter last year, and were derived mainly from deferred royalty payments from ADM for CLARISOY™ sales. The nominal revenues reflect the company's development phase status as it transitions to the commercial stage.

Royalty revenues from the sale by ADM of CLARISOY™ as produced from their semi-works facility in Decatur, Illinois have been marginal. The main purpose of the semi-works plant has been to provide commercial samples for market development purposes and to facilitate other product development work.

Third quarter net loss totaled $1.8 million or $(0.05) per basic and diluted share, as compared to a net loss of $1.5 million or $(0.05) per basic and diluted share in the same year-ago quarter.

Research and development (R&D) expenses totalled $647,000 in the third quarter, increasing from $588,000 in the same year-ago quarter, due mostly to higher plant operating costs and stock-based compensation expense.

General and administrative (G&A) expenses in the third quarter increased to $1.2 million from $1.1 million in the year-ago quarter. The higher G&A expenses is attributed to an increase of $115,000 in patent legal fees and expenses from higher activity levels, and offset mainly by a decrease in investor relations expenses due to an extensive European roadshow undertaken in the third quarter of last year.

At December 31, 2014, cash totaled $3.0 million compared to $1.4 million at March 31, 2014. Subsequent to the quarter-end, Burcon completed a private placement for US$1.65 million. Together with the proceeds from the private placement, management believes it has sufficient resources to fund its expected level of operations and working capital requirements until at least November 2015. This estimate does not take into account potential proceeds from outstanding convertible securities, anticipated increases in royalty revenues from the sale of CLARISOY™, or any other potential revenue from product sales or licensing.

About Burcon NutraScience Corporation

Burcon NutraScience is a leader in developing functionally and nutritionally valuable plant-based proteins. The company has developed a portfolio of composition, application, and process patents originating from a core protein extraction and purification technology. Burcon's CLARISOY™ soy protein offers clarity and high-quality protein nutrition for low pH beverage systems and excellent solubility and exceptionally clean flavor at any pH; Peazazz® is a uniquely soluble and clean-tasting pea protein; and Puratein®, Supertein™ and Nutratein® are canola protein isolates with unique functional and nutritional attributes.
